Counting Cards In Blackjack

If you are an enthusiast of 21 then you need to be conscious of the fact that in black jack quite a few events of your prior play can disturb your up-and-coming play. It is unlike any other gambling den games such as roulette or craps in which there is little effect of the previous action on the unfolding one. In vingt-et-un if a gambler has left over cards of big proportion then it is constructive for the player in up-coming rounds and if the gambler has awful cards, it negatively alters his up-coming hands. In nearly all of the instances it is very demanding for the player to recount the cards which have been consumed in the previous matches in particular in the multiple pack shoe. Each and every left over card in the shoe gets some positive, negative or zero point value for the card counting.

Typically it is seen that cards with small points for instance 2, 3 provide a favorable distinction and the bigger cards make a a negative value. The different points are attached for all cards based on the card counting scheme. Although it is more efficient to make a count on counter’s personal best guess as it relates to cards dealt and cards not yet dealt a few times the counter will be able to have a total of the point values in her brain. This will aid you to ascertain the precise percentage or value of cards that are still in the pack. You will want to realize that the higher the point values the more challenging the card counting activity is. Multiple-level card counting intensifies the adversity although the counting action that is comprised of lower value like 1, -1, 0 known as level 1 counting is the easiest.

When it comes to getting a blackjack then the value of aces is greater than all other cards. Consequently the action towards aces is extremely critical in the process of counting cards in chemin de fer.

The gambler will be able to make bigger wagers if the pack of cards is in her favour and smaller wagers when the pack is not. The player will be able to modify her choices according to the cards and wager with a secure strategy. If the method of card counting is absolutely authentic and accurate the outcome on the game will be favorable, this is why the dice joints apply counteractions to prevent card counting.
